Job Description:

BAE Systems is seeking Space Operations Specialists to support a mission critical intelligence customer. Our Space Operations Specialist II provides leadership and direct support to ensure health and safety, longevity, and daily mission support to on orbit space vehicle(s). This includes space vehicle command and control, telemetry analysis, trending, orbit analysis, sensor calibrations, and anomaly resolution. This work is performed primarily in an office environment at a government site near Denver, Colorado. Some travel and local commute between BAE campuses and other possible non-BAE locations CONUS and OCONUS locations may be required.
